11 Whitehawk Road, Brighton, BN2 5FA is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 646 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£291,766 , which equates to approximately £452 per square foot. It was last sold on 26 Mar 2021 for £262,000. Since then, the value has increased by £29,766, representing a 11.4% increase, or approximately 2.2% per year.

The current estimated value of £291,766 is:

  • 11.5% lower than the average property price on Whitehawk Road
  • 15.7% lower than the average in the BN2 5FA postcode area
  • and 39.2% lower than the average price for Brighton as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 11 July 2016,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

EPC Summary

11 Whitehawk Road, Brighton, Brighton And Hove, East Sussex, BN2 5FA has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 11 Jul 2016.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are mostly double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 26 Apr 2013. The rating of D is unchanged, though the energy efficiency score decreased by 7.5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water energy efficiency improving from good to very good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 100 mm loft insulation to pitched, no insulation (assumed), changing energy efficiency from average to very poor.
  • The windows were upgraded from fully double glazed to mostly double glazing.
  • The lighting was changed from low energy lighting in 29%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 25% of fixed outlets, with no change in efficiency (average).

Flood risk from rivers and the sea

This property has very low flood risk from rivers and the sea.

River and sea flooding includes flooding caused by overflowing rivers, estuaries, tidal waters and coastal surges.

Flood risk from surface water

This property has medium surface water flood risk.

Surface water flooding can happen when heavy rainfall overwhelms drains, roads, gardens or other hard surfaces.
